Please note that all ticket prices are exclusive of VAT. Standard UK VAT of 20% will be charged on each ticket. 
  • UK attendees/ exhibitors will be eligible to recover the input VAT on their own VAT returns subject to the normal VAT recovery rules.

  • Non-UK organisations which may not be registered for VAT in the UK may still be eligible to make a claim to HMRC to recover the VAT on costs associated with the event by submitting a 13th Directive claim to HMRC.

  • Additional information on submitting a 13th Directive claim can be found in HMRC Notice 723A - Refunds of UK VAT for non-UK businesses
